Vajreshwari Devi Temple In Chamba Town

Vajreshwari Devi Temple in Chamba town, Himachal Pradesh, was built during the 11th century CE. The temple is famous for its striking sculptures and inscriptions. The temple walls area filled with beautiful sculptures.

The temple has a carved stone murti of Mahishasura Mardini.

The shrine is built on a platform and has wooden chhatris.

The temple was renovated during the late 17th century CE by Udai Singh.
